Accordingly, when deciding on the manner and method of teaching spelling, today's instructors would be well-advised to take great care to identify and use research-supported methods, which is admittedly challenging given the plethora of available instructional methods and different levels of evidence regarding the efficacy of each. After those considerations had been accounted for, only 4% of English spellings could be regarded as unpredictable (Joshi et al., 2008). Evidence favoring explicit instruction included: (a) reading can yield some incidental learning of spelling, but such learning is modest compared with explicit instruction, and (b) writing yields modest and inconsistent improvements in spelling ability. The English language's Anglo-Saxon roots, as modified by the influence of other languages, such as Greek, Latin, and French, have led to a language that is efficient by some measures, such as number of words needed to express a request or issue a warning, and which is characterized by competing spelling rules and frequent mismatches between spelling and pronunciation. In the early 21st century, however, skepticism as to the importance of spelling has grown, some schools have deemphasized or abandoned spelling instruction altogether, and there has been a proliferation of non-traditional approaches to teaching spelling. 1966, see also Hanna and Moore, 1953, Treiman and Kessler, 2003, Kreiner et al., 2002, Ziegler et al., 1997) conducted a series of computer analyses of over 17, 000 English words and found that approximately half could be spelled using simple sound-letter combinations (i. e., phonics), over one-third were regular except for one sound, and most of the remainder could be derived using etymological information (e. g., having a prefix of Greek origin). The increased use of electronic methods of communication wherein correct spelling and formal writing style are not required may also be a factor: survey data indicate a shift toward informal writing styles among US teenagers (Lenhart et al., 2008), although such shifts have not yet supplanted traditional approaches to writing (Lunsford & Lunsford, 2008).
